15-05-1994 дата публикации

СМАЗОЧНОЕ МАСЛО ДЛЯ ДВИГАТЕЛЕЙ ВНУТРЕННЕГО СГОРАНИЯ

Номер: RU2012592C1

FIELD: internal combustion engines. SUBSTANCE: lubricating oil contains, mass % : imperfect ester of fatty acid and polihydric alcohol 0.01-2.00, product of interaction of polyisobutylene succinic acid and alkelenepolyamine 0.01-0.15, metal salt of dialkyldithiophosphoric acid 0.01-2.00, petroleum oil to 100. Mentioned above product is prepared on the base of polyisobutylene succinic acid containing 1,3-4 groups of succinic acid per equivalent mass of polyisobutylene, its numerical mean molecular weight being 1300-1500, ratio mass mean molecular weight and numerical mean molecular weight being 1.5-4.5. Quantity of alkylenepolyamine is 1-2 molar equivalents per 1 equivalent of acid. Said salt dialkyldithiophosphoric acid contains isopropyl or secondary butyl, another alkyl contains 5-13 carbon atoms, molar content of isopropyl or secondary butyl groups being 10-90% . Metal of II group of periodic table, namely Al, Sn, Fe, Co, Pb, Mo, Mn, Ni, or Cu forms said salt. 09-07-1952 дата публикации

Aerogels and grease compositions made therefrom

Номер: GB0000675301A
Автор:
Принадлежит:

A lubricating grease composition comprises a major proportion of an organic liquid possessing lubricating properties and a minor proportion of a non-collapsed soap aerogel. The organic liquid possessing lubricating properties may be mineral lubricating oil, a synthetic hydrocarbon, an organic ester, an organic polymer or a fluorinated hydrocarbon, and a list of suitable liquids is given. The soaps from which the non-collapsed soap aerogels can be made may be metal or organic base salts of fatty materials and mixtures thereof. Saponifiable materials which may be used to form soaps are fats and oils of animal, vegetable, marine or fish origin, fatty acids derived from such fats and oils, the hydrogenated or sulphurized products of such fatty acids, and the substitution derivatives of such fatty acids for example the mercapto amino or halogen substituted fatty acids. Saponifiable materials from other sources such as napthenic acids, tall oil fatty acids, rosin acids and acids produced by the ...

09-09-1953 дата публикации

Improvements in and relating to metal-working lubricants

Номер: GB0000696960A
Автор:
Принадлежит:

A composition for use as a lubricant comprises as essential ingredients (1) a blend containing at least 80 per cent, based on the weight of the blend, of a substantially non-aromatic waxy hydrocarbon and a polymer of a hydrocarbon having an aliphatic unsaturated bond, and (2) a halogen substituted organic compound containing at least eight carbon atoms in the molecule in an amount of 2 to 10 per cent by weight of the whole composition. The composition may also contain minor amounts of high molecular weight fatty acids derived from animal, vegetable or marine oils, high molecular weight fatty acids, esters of the above acids with mono- or poly-hydric alcohols and sulphur-containing materials. The waxy hydrocarbon, which may be obtained from petroleum oils, may be slop waxes, petrolatum stock, slack waxes, scale waxes, paraffin waxes, malcrystalline and needle waxes, or micro-crystalline waxes. If desired these waxy hydrocarbons may be mixed with synthetic waxes produced by dehydrating long-chain ...

21-06-1967 дата публикации

Improvements in or relating to hydraulic fluids

Номер: GB0001072830A
Принадлежит:

Hydraulic fluids, which are free from selenium and tellurium compounds, comprise a major proportion of one or more polyoxyalkylene glycols or ethers thereof as base fluid, and a minor proportion of a dialkyl citrate, the alkyl groups of which contain on average 3 1/2 -13 carbon atoms. The pH of the fluids may be adjusted to above pH 8 by addition of diamylamine, morpholine, triethanolamine, or a mixture thereof. Benzotriazole may also be present.

05-10-1936 дата публикации

Fluid composition

Номер: GB0000454628A
Автор:
Принадлежит:

... 454,628. Hydraulic liquids. DOELLING, G. L., 3142, Clifton Avenue, St. Louis, Missouri, U.S.A. April 3, 1935, No. 10380. [Class 69 (ii)] A hydraulic fluid is composed of one or more mono- or di-ricinoleates of mono-, di-, or trihydric alcohols having 1-5 C. atoms in the molecule, dissolved in a solvent inert to the esters, rubber, and metals, of low viscosity and freezing point, and of relatively high vaporizing point. Suitable solvents are glycol ethers, e.g. ethylene glycol ethyl ether, and aliphatic alcohols having no more than 6 C. atoms in the molecule, e.g. ethyl, propyl, diacetone, or tetrahydrofurfuryl alcohol. Suitable esters are mono- or di-ricinoleate of glycerine or glycols or polyglycols, and methyl, ethyl, or butyl ricinoleate. A neutralizing agent, e.g. potassium arsenite and castor oil may be added. Preferred compositions are :- (1) 1 vol. of glyceryl di-ricinoleate with 1 vol. of diacetone alcohol; and (2) 3 vol. of methyl ricinoleate, with 20 vol. of castor oil and 50 ...

Подробнее
15-03-1983 дата публикации

Lubricant composition

Номер: US4376711A
Автор: Harold Shaub
Принадлежит: Exxon Research and Engineering Co

An additive combination comprising a hydroxysubstituted ester of a polycarboxylic acid and a metal dihydrocarbyl dithiophosphate and lubricating compositions comprising the same. The lubricating compositions comprising these additives exhibit improved anti-friction and anti-wear properties. Best results are achieved when the ester is obtained from a dimer acid and particularly a dimer of a fatty acid containing conjugated unsaturation. The metal used in the metal dialkyl dithiophosphate must be one having a relatively soft metal oxide and particularly a metal oxide having a Mohs hardness of about 3 or less.

02-09-1971 дата публикации

Oil-soluble graft polymers derived from degraded ethylene-propylene interpolymers

Номер: GB1244435A
Автор:
Принадлежит: Lubrizol Corp

1,244,435. Graft polymers. LUBRIZOL CORP. 29 April, 1969 [18 June, 1968], No. 21817/69. Heading C3G. [Also in Division C5] An oil-soluble polymer contains units derived from an oxygen-containing monomer grafted on to an oxidized, degraded interpolymer of ethylene and propylene, said oxidized, degraded interpolymer having a molecular weight of 1000 to 200,000 and being formed by contacting an ethylene-propylene interpolymer having a molecular weight of 50,000 to 800,000 with oxygen at a temperature of at least 100‹ C. for a period of time sufficient to effect a substantial reduction in the molecular weight of said interpolymer. The interpolymer, which is preferably derived from ethylene, propylene and a minor amount of a mono-olefin or polyene e.g. a non- conjugated diene, is oxidized and degraded by bubbling oxygen or air through a heated solution of the interpolymer, or by blowing air over the surface of the solution while the solution is subjected to shearing agitation. Alternatively, the degradation and grafting are effected simultaneously. Preferred graft monomers are vinyl esters of saturated carboxylic acids, N-vinyl lactams and N-oxohydrocarbon or sulphohydrocarbon acrylamides. In examples, (a) a degraded ethylene/propylene/1,4-hexadiene interpolymer is grafted with diethylaminoethyl methacrylate or decyl methacrylate; and (b) a degraded ethylene/propylene/dicyclopentadiene interpolymer is grafted with 2-hydroxyethyl methacrylate, vinyl acetate, N-vinylpyrrolidone, methacrylic acid, diethylaminoethyl methacrylate, an ester of methacrylic with an alcohol derived from a wax having a molecular weight of about 350, N - (1,1 - dimethyl - 3 - oxobutyl) acrylamide, a vinyl ester of a saturated carboxylic acid containing about 10 carbon atoms or 2 - acrylamido - 2 - methylpropane - 1 - sulphonic acid. The graft polymer obtained using methacrylic acid is reacted with N-(3-aminopropyl) morpholine. The graft polymers are incorporated in mineral oil lubricants.
